Table of Contents
- Introduction
- Understanding Why Testing Matters for Online Stores
- Performance Testing to Ensure Speed and Stability
- Functional Testing for a Seamless Shopping Journey
- Cross-Browser and Cross-Device Testing for Consistency
- Usability Testing to Improve User Experience
- Security Testing to Protect Customers and Build Trust
- Regression Testing to Maintain Stability During Updates
- Automation Testing for Speed and Scalability
- Monitoring and Continuous Testing for Long-Term Success
- The Conclusion
Introduction
Try picturing what it would mean to see your online business through the eyes of those consumers browsing. You would see where they linger, the doubts creeping into their minds, and the unseen barriers that quietly thwart the buying process. This level of understanding results from the process of systematic testing and moves beyond the hopes and dreams stages, where one relies on mere guesses and hopes their online business performs accordingly, without ever putting it through the test of systematic testing.
Understanding Why Testing Matters for Online Stores
Online stores are complex systems consisting of many interfaces, servers, external integrations, and payment channels. An inefficient link could mean a store performs slowly or inefficiently. Testing brings these trouble spots to light before customers stumble upon them. A page taking too long to load a product view, a step in the ordering process that doesn’t play well, or a feature behaving quirkily on a mobile device. More than just looking for errors to fix, testing shows you how people really behave in your store so you can simplify the paths to higher engagement.
Performance Testing to Ensure Speed and Stability
Performance testing is the nucleus of a fast-loading e-commerce website. Slow-loading pages are the bane of visitors, leading to poor search rankings too. This kind of testing ensures your e-commerce site remains resilient in all scenarios, from peak holiday sales to flash sales. It ensures your server, databases, and APIs are ready to handle the extra burden of traffic and are not brought down. This way, you ensure your website loads rapidly when the traffic hits the roof.
Functional Testing for a Seamless Shopping Journey
Functional testing ensures that each and every aspect of your e-commerce site is performing as expected. Whether you are browsing a product or using filters to shortlist, whether you are adding to the cart or checking out, each and every process must be perfect. Also, the application of discounts, the updating of the stock level in real time, and the confirmation emails will be sent perfectly to the customers. If that happens, the customers will trust the site more and will not abandon their carts because of the glitches they are facing.
Cross-Browser and Cross-Device Testing for Consistency
Contemporary consumers will be found to be using all different types of browsers, operating systems, and devices upon browsing online stores. Cross-browser and cross-platform testing ensures that consumers perceive the same look and feel on desktop, tablet, and mobile when browsing. Layout design, buttons, input fields, and site navigation should react seamlessly, irrespective of viewing platform. By testing an app on different platforms, we can avoid layout bugs and unresponsive elements before consumers encounter one.
Usability Testing to Improve User Experience
Usability testing is about the simplicity and welcome factor of your online shop. It simply confirms whether the customer can easily find the product, whether the price details are clear, and whether the customer can complete the purchase without hassle. It's the entire process that points out the problem areas, the unclear call-to-action buttons, the cluttered pages, and the conversions, which, rather than being the "straight and narrow", are more like a maze!
Security Testing to Protect Customers and Build Trust
Security is a major part of the performance of any online store. You have customers who share very sensitive information with you, personal information and financial information. The potential vulnerabilities that can be exploited for interception of the data and other fraudulent activities are identified by security testing. Security testing helps you stay up-to-date on the latest standards of security and protects your store against new security threats every day.
Regression Testing to Maintain Stability During Updates
Online stores constantly undergo changes: new features are developed, design is renewed, and connections with third-party services get established. Regression testing serves as protection, an assurance that these updates will not ruin what was already working properly. Every time a change is made, core workflows should be tested again to assure businesses can confidently push improvements out without any surprises. This kind of testing is ever so important in fast-growing e-commerce platforms that do releases frequently enough to try and stay ahead.
Automation Testing for Speed and Scalability
With your online business growing, manual testing of every feature is simply impractical. That’s where test automation enters the picture because it is much more efficient at performing repeat tests, as it can do them quickly without making as many errors. Automation testing benefits regression testing and performance testing, as well as functional testing, which is done best on an ongoing, regular routine cycle, rather than all at once.
Monitoring and Continuous Testing for Long-Term Success
Testing is not a one-and-done process. Continuous testing and monitoring enable you to identify issues with performance in a real-time manner, even after you've launched your online store. Continuous monitoring of loading speed, errors, and user activities allows you to resolve issues before they can be experienced by your customers. Having a testing mentality will also enable your e-commerce site to adapt to the changing manner of user behavior and to new technologies.
The Conclusion
Online shopping optimization is not merely an aesthetic or product play, it's an ongoing testing discipline. By integrating performance testing with functionality testing, usability testing, security testing, and automation testing, you can build engaging and robust shopping experiences that are quick and reliable. When testing becomes an extension of the QA process with the aim to optimize, online shopping can definitely scale successfully while ensuring happy customers.
If you are interested in learning how you can optimize the testing on your e-commerce platform to take your business to the next level, contact us today. We are ready to help you achieve success.
